does anyone know if there is a poisons hotline in hong kong, where you can ring up to find out whether someone (usually a kid!) has ingested something poisonous or not.

i've tried googling it, but didn't have any luck.
 
There is the department of Health 2961 8989, but I'm not sure it's the right place. I would just call the emergency services 999.
 
There is none, apparently - but if you use Skype and have credit, you can actually call 1800 numbers in the US or Australia for free. I'd just be writing down one of those and trying that... And of course if they're really bad, then call 999. But if in doubt about it, I'd call one of the oseas ones...
